American Basswood belongs to the family Tiliaceae and Red Fescue belongs to the family Poaceae.

Also, when you compare American Basswood and Red Fescue, other factors should also be taken into considerations like order, subfamilies, tribe, clade etc. First plant's genus is Tilia and other plant's genus is Festuca. American Basswood tribe is Tileae and Red Fescue tribe is Not Available. American Basswood clade is Angiosperms, Eudicots and Rosids and order is Malvales whereas Red Fescue clade is Angiosperms, Commelinids and Monocots and order is Cyperales. Every plant have subfamilies. American Basswood subfamilies are, Tilioideae and Red Fescue subfamilies are Not Available.
